Perhaps you’re a recent graduate with limited professional experience, or you’re making a significant career change and need to reframe your entire narrative. In these situations, a full resume writing service might be the better choice. These professionals can help you brainstorm your transferable skills, identify key achievements, and craft a compelling story from scratch. They understand how to translate your unique background into language that resonates with recruiters and hiring managers in industries prevalent in the US, such as tech, healthcare, or finance. For example, if you’re moving from a customer service role into project management, a writer can help you highlight your organizational, problem-solving, and leadership skills in a way that aligns with project management expectations, even if you haven’t held a formal PM title. This comprehensive approach ensures your resume not only looks good but also strategically positions you for your desired career path. Regardless of whether you opt for editing or full writing services, the importance of tailoring your resume cannot be overstated. Generic resumes rarely impress. In the United States, employers often use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) to scan resumes for keywords and phrases that match the job description. A professional service can help you identify these crucial keywords and integrate them naturally into your resume, increasing your chances of passing the initial ATS screening. For instance, if a job posting for a Marketing Manager emphasizes “digital marketing strategy,” “SEO optimization,” and “campaign management,” your resume should reflect these terms if they apply to your experience. A good resume writer or editor will ensure these elements are present and prominent. A recent survey indicated that over 75% of Fortune 500 companies utilize ATS, making this step vital for job seekers.
